Our Research Program focuses on three thrust areas with ten sub-thrusts. Researchers from across partner campuses provide critical expertise, research capabilities and leadership.

System Demonstration

  • 1MW FREEDM System Green Energy Hub Demonstration
  • Intelligent Energy Management (IEM) Subsystem
  • Intelligent Fault Management (IFM) Subsystem
  • Plug-in Hybrid Electric vehicle (PHEV) and Plug-in Electric vehicle (PEV)

Enabling Technologies

  • Reliable and Secured Communications (RSC)
  • Distributed Grid Intelligence (DGI)
  • Distributed Energy Storage Device (DESD)
  • Fault Isolation Device (FID)
  • Solid-State Transformer (SST)

Fundamental Science

  • Systems Theory Modeling and Control (SMC)
  • Advanced Storage (AS)
  • Post-Silicon Devices (PSD)

Highlighting the research program will be a 1 megawatt FREEDM System demonstration grid for renewable energy on the NC State Centennial Campus.
